Vin Diesel

Introduction

Vin Diesel, born Mark Sinclair Vincent on July 18, 1967, is an American actor, producer, director, and screenwriter. He is best known for his tough-guy roles in action films, particularly as Dominic Toretto in the "Fast & Furious" franchise.

Vin Diesel first gained recognition for his performance in the 1998 film "Saving Private Ryan," directed by Steven Spielberg. However, it was his role as Dominic Toretto in the 2001 film "The Fast and the Furious" that truly catapulted him to stardom. His portrayal of the street racing ex-convict who values family above all else struck a chord with audiences, leading to the success of the franchise and establishing Diesel as an action star.

Aside from his work in the "Fast & Furious" series, Vin Diesel has appeared in numerous other successful films, including "xXx," "The Chronicles of Riddick," and "Guardians of the Galaxy." He has also lent his voice to the character of Groot in the Marvel Cinematic Universe.

Early Life and Background

Vin Diesel, whose real name is Mark Sinclair, was born on July 18, 1967, in Alameda County, California. He was raised in New York City by his mother, Delora Sherleen Vincent, an astrologer, and his stepfather, Irving H. Vincent, an acting instructor and theater manager. Diesel never met his biological father and was raised by his stepfather, whom he refers to as his father.

Growing up, Diesel showed an early interest in acting and performing. He made his stage debut at the age of seven in a children's play and continued to pursue acting throughout his school years. Despite facing challenges and adversity, including being bullied for his mixed ethnicity (he is of African-American and Caucasian descent), Diesel remained focused on his passion for acting.

After high school, Diesel attended Hunter College in New York City but dropped out to pursue his acting career. Career Beginnings

Vin Diesel, born Mark Sinclair on July 18, 1967, began his career in entertainment at a young age. Growing up in New York City, he was exposed to the performing arts and developed a love for acting. Diesel's early interests and talents included writing, directing, and producing short films, which he would often showcase to his friends and family.

His first big break came when he wrote, directed, and starred in the short film "Multi-Facial" in 1995, which was screened at the Cannes Film Festival. This led to his first feature film role in the 1998 movie "Saving Private Ryan," where he played Private Adrian Caparzo and garnered critical acclaim for his performance.

However, it was his role as Dominic Toretto in the 2001 film "The Fast and the Furious" that catapulted Vin Diesel to international fame. His portrayal of the street racer and mechanic not only showcased his acting abilities but also solidified his status as an action star.

Personal Life

Vin Diesel, born Mark Sinclair on July 18, 1967, in Alameda County, California, is known for his roles in action-packed movies such as the Fast and Furious franchise and the Riddick series. Beyond his on-screen persona as a tough and fearless action hero, Vin Diesel leads a fascinating personal life filled with significant relationships, family ties, diverse interests, and a strong commitment to philanthropy and activism.

In terms of relationships, Vin Diesel has been in a long-term relationship with Paloma Jimenez, a Mexican model, since 2007. The couple shares three children together - daughter Hania Riley, son Vincent Sinclair, and daughter Pauline, named in honor of Vin Diesel's close friend and Fast and Furious co-star, Paul Walker, who tragically passed away in a car accident in 2013. Vin Diesel has spoken openly about the profound impact of Paul Walker's friendship and the loss he experienced.

Interesting Facts and Trivia

Vin Diesel, whose real name is Mark Sinclair, is a multi-talented actor, producer, director, and screenwriter known for his tough-guy roles in action movies. Here are some interesting facts and trivia about him:

1. Dungeons & Dragons fan
Vin Diesel is a huge fan of the tabletop role-playing game Dungeons & Dragons. He even wrote the foreword for the book "30 Years of Adventure: A Celebration of Dungeons & Dragons."
